Visualizzazione dei risultati da 1 a 9 su 9
  1. #1

    Timeout sessione, come funziona?

    Salve, ho modificato tramite una pagina php il timeout di una sessione. L'ho modificato nella pagina dove la sessione viene creata e quindi dove va fatto il login, tramite una ini_set().
    La mia domanda è: una volta modificata in questa pagina il tiemeout è settato per la sessione in generale giusto? Quindi non serve ribadire il concetto con altre ini_set per ogni pagina in cui viene usata una sessione. Ho capito o mi sfugget qualcosa?

    Grazie a chi mi darà una mano!
    I dilettanti costruirono l'Arca, i professionisti il Titanic!

  2. #2
    vale per le sole pagine in cui viene settato. Non viene scritto da alcuna parte, viene usato per valutare la validita' della sessione e quindi va pure messo prima di session_start().

    in mancanza di questa indicazione verra' usato il valore definito nel php.ini o in .htaccess

    Il silenzio è spesso la cosa migliore. Pensa ... è gratis.

  3. #3
    aspè aspè posso metterlo anche in htaccess?? Come si fa? In questo modo metto un solo file e mi vale per ogni session_start vero?
    I dilettanti costruirono l'Arca, i professionisti il Titanic!

  4. #4
    Originariamente inviato da Nunkij
    aspè aspè posso metterlo anche in htaccess?? Come si fa? In questo modo metto un solo file e mi vale per ogni session_start vero?
    php_flag "session.gc_maxlifetime" "1000"

    1000 secondi o quello che ti pare. ....

    Il silenzio è spesso la cosa migliore. Pensa ... è gratis.

  5. #5
    Utente di HTML.it L'avatar di dottwatson
    Registrato dal
    Feb 2007
    Messaggi
    3,012
    Originariamente inviato da piero.mac
    php_flag "session.gc_maxlifetime" "1000"

    1000 secondi o quello che ti pare. ....
    questa non la conoscevo ... :master:

    quali altri parametri posso impostare inoltre?
    dove mi posso documentare??
    Non sempre essere l'ultimo è un male... almeno non devi guardarti le spalle

    il mio profilo su PHPClasses e il mio blog laboweb

  6. #6
    Ho trovato questa pillola proprio qui!

    http://forum.html.it/forum/showthrea...postid=5314248

    Ti potrà essere utile, anzi CI potrà essere utile!
    I dilettanti costruirono l'Arca, i professionisti il Titanic!

  7. #7
    Utente di HTML.it L'avatar di dottwatson
    Registrato dal
    Feb 2007
    Messaggi
    3,012
    eccezionale!!

    mel a studio subitissimo
    Non sempre essere l'ultimo è un male... almeno non devi guardarti le spalle

    il mio profilo su PHPClasses e il mio blog laboweb

  8. #8
    Se metto nella root un file htaccess fatto con quella riga però ricevo un internal server error, come mai?

    Nel file ho

    php_value "session.gc_maxlifetime" "3600"

    ho provato anche con

    php_flag "session.gc_maxlifetime" "3600"
    I dilettanti costruirono l'Arca, i professionisti il Titanic!

  9. #9
    Può dipendere dal fatto che php è installato come cgi?
    I dilettanti costruirono l'Arca, i professionisti il Titanic!

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.